All Our Heart

Picture of a BibleOur hearts is the heart of the matter when our relationship with God is concerned. When He has our hearts, He has all of us. He asked that we love Him with all our hearts in Deuteronomy 6:5 and in Proverbs 23:26 He says in very clear terms, “My son, give me your heart…”
God desires to have our hearts so that we can walk perfect before Him, He wants to know that He has the whole occupancy of our hearts and is not in competition with anyone or anything over our hearts. When He knows this, He is then at liberty to pour forth on us all that He has for us, because He knows that He can depend on our loyalty to Him. For Him your heart and my heart is truly the heart of the matter.

And he said, O Lord, the God of Israel, there is no God like You in heaven above or on earth beneath, keeping covenant and showing mercy and loving-kindness to Your servants who walk before You with all their heart. 1 Kings 8:23 (AMP)
